      Re: Protein

      If you are lifting weights the protein is important for your muscles. Another help is L-glutamine as a supplement. It is one of the amino acids that helps rebuild your muscle tissue after a workout and it has the added benefit of being an appetite suppressant (although I never noticed that aspect myself). I have also never seen anything on adverse effects of L Glutamine unlike many other supplements. It's safety was one of the reasons I decided to add it to my daily regimen.
